write the equation of the line that is parallel to the line y = 2x 2 and passes through the point (5, 3). a. y = 2x - 7 b. y=-1/
Jlenok [28]
Parallel lines has equal slopes. Line y = 2x + 2 has a slope of 2, hence required slope is 2
Required equation is y - y1 = 2(x - x1)
y - 3 = 2(x - 5)
y - 3 = 2x - 10
y = 2x - 10 + 3
y = 2x - 7
